    I have one of these. The mag itself works fine, but the stripper loader is very clumsy to use. Not how it's Advertised at all. I definitely like the extra 20 rounds stored in the side. I was going to sell mine when I sold my 10/22 but I plan to get a takedown at some point and this would be the perfect mag for a survival gun.
